Relaxation and Localization in Interacting Quantum Maps

A. Lakshminarayan, N. L. Balazs

chao-dynarXiv:chao-dyn/9307003

Abstract

We quantise and study several versions of finite multibaker maps. Classically these are exactly solvable K-systems with known exponential decay to global equilibrium. This is an attempt to construct simple models of relaxation in quantum systems. The effect of symmetries and localization on quantum transport is discussed.
